Sweden-Number/dlls/ntdll
Huw Davies 5c8ea25014 ntdll: Use CLOCK_REALTIME_COARSE for NtQuerySystemTime() if it has sufficient resolution.
This will only affect users running with HZ=1000.  On an i7-8700 CPU @
3.20GHz it cuts the call cost from ~30ns to ~12ns.

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2019-05-14 20:26:46 +02:00
..
tests ntdll: Initialize critical section debug info with correct pointer value. 2019-04-30 20:08:04 +02:00
Makefile.in
actctx.c ntdll: Use strncmpiW instead of memicmpW for strings without embedded nulls. 2019-05-08 08:34:32 -05:00
atom.c
cdrom.c Avoid using Windows includes that are already handled in wine/port.h. 2019-03-12 20:19:00 +01:00
critsection.c ntdll: Initialize critical section debug info with correct pointer value. 2019-04-30 20:08:04 +02:00
debugbuffer.c
debugtools.c ntdll: Store offsets instead of pointers in the debug_info structure. 2019-04-03 19:28:19 +02:00
directory.c ntdll: Use strncmpiW instead of memicmpW for strings without embedded nulls. 2019-05-08 08:34:32 -05:00
env.c ntdll: Recreate the process parameters structure once everything has been initialized. 2019-02-13 19:45:24 +01:00
error.c
exception.c ntdll: Define IsBadStringPtr to handle exceptions in debug traces. 2019-04-04 11:34:04 +02:00
file.c ntdll: Avoid crashing while tracing parameters to NtCreateNamedPipeFile(). 2019-04-08 09:55:23 +02:00
handletable.c
heap.c ntdll: Avoid using DPRINTF(). 2019-04-08 19:34:09 +02:00
large_int.c include: Move inline assembly definitions to a new wine/asm.h header. 2019-05-14 13:45:07 +02:00
loader.c ntdll: Account for null terminating char in unload traces (Coverity). 2019-04-30 20:05:27 +02:00
loadorder.c
misc.c
nt.c ntdll: Use the correct type for %llu scanf format. 2019-04-23 23:50:45 +02:00
ntdll.spec ntdll: Implement RtlGetSystemTimePrecise(). 2019-05-14 20:24:45 +02:00
ntdll_misc.h include: Move inline assembly definitions to a new wine/asm.h header. 2019-05-14 13:45:07 +02:00
om.c Avoid using Windows includes that are already handled in wine/port.h. 2019-03-12 20:19:00 +01:00
path.c
printf.c ntdll: Use NTDLL_tolower instead of toupper. 2019-03-26 13:50:22 +01:00
process.c ntdll: Reset stdio file descriptors when passed invalid handles. 2019-05-07 15:03:58 -05:00
reg.c ntdll: Add DECLSPEC_HOTPATCH to NtQueryValueKey. 2019-04-19 12:02:58 +02:00
relay.c ntdll: Use _stricmp instead of strcasecmp. 2019-03-26 13:50:20 +01:00
resource.c include: Move inline assembly definitions to a new wine/asm.h header. 2019-05-14 13:45:07 +02:00
rtl.c ntdll: Implement RtlGetUnloadEventTrace()/RtlGetUnloadEventTraceEx(). 2019-04-23 23:50:44 +02:00
rtlbitmap.c
rtlstr.c ntdll: Default to 7-bit ASCII before codepages are initialized. 2019-03-22 19:45:39 +01:00
sec.c
serial.c Avoid using Windows includes that are already handled in wine/port.h. 2019-03-12 20:19:00 +01:00
server.c
signal_arm.c ntdll: Reuse signal to trap translation for FreeBSD on ARM. 2019-04-22 19:48:28 +02:00
signal_arm64.c ntdll: Add stub for RtlInstallFunctionTableCallback on ARM/ARM64. 2019-04-01 23:25:49 +02:00
signal_i386.c ntdll: Mark 'float_status' as input operand in save_fpu(). 2019-03-06 18:28:20 +01:00
signal_powerpc.c ntdll: Rename attach_dlls() to LdrInitializeThunk(). 2019-02-14 17:57:09 +01:00
signal_x86_64.c ntdll: Fix unwinding from leaf function on x86_64. 2019-03-20 22:42:30 +01:00
string.c ntdll: Use RtlUpperChar in _strupr implementation. 2019-03-27 22:01:07 +01:00
sync.c ntdll: Add support for returning previous state argument in event functions. 2019-03-12 20:34:35 +01:00
tape.c
thread.c ntdll: Store offsets instead of pointers in the debug_info structure. 2019-04-03 19:28:19 +02:00
threadpool.c ntdll/threadpool: Add support for callback priority. 2019-03-13 10:59:50 +01:00
time.c ntdll: Use CLOCK_REALTIME_COARSE for NtQuerySystemTime() if it has sufficient resolution. 2019-05-14 20:26:46 +02:00
version.c
version.rc
virtual.c server: Add flag for builtin dlls in the image information. 2019-04-22 11:34:25 +02:00
wcstring.c